Argentina's Shocking Loss: A Full Match Analysis Against Saudi Arabia

The 2022 World Cup has already witnessed its fair share of surprises, but perhaps none as significant as Argentina's loss to Saudi Arabia. In a thrilling Group C match, the South American giants were defeated 2-1 by their Middle Eastern opponents, leaving fans stunned worldwide. This analysis delves into the match's intricacies, exploring what went wrong for Argentina and what made Saudi Arabia's victory so memorable.

From the kickoff, it was clear that Saudi Arabia had come prepared to face one of the tournament's favorites. Their strategy involved employing a high-intensity press, aiming to disrupt Argentina's rhythm and limit their creative freedom. This approach paid dividends, as Argentina found themselves struggling to maintain possession and create scoring opportunities in the first half.

First Half: Saudi Arabia's Tactical Masterclass

Saudi Arabia's tactical setup was pivotal in nullifying Argentina's attacking prowess. By deploying a compact defensive block, they managed to thwart Lionel Messi and his teammates' attempts to weave through their defense. The absence of clear-cut chances for Argentina was a testament to the effectiveness of Saudi Arabia's strategy. Meanwhile, Saudi Arabia capitalized on their rare forays into Argentine territory, eventually breaking the deadlock through Saleh Al-Shehri's well-crafted goal.

The lead was short-lived, however, as Lionel Messi converted a penalty to level the score just before halftime. Despite this, Saudi Arabia's morale remained unshaken, and they entered the second half with a clear plan to further exploit Argentina's defensive vulnerabilities.

Second Half: The Turning Point

The match's decisive moment arrived in the 53rd minute, courtesy of Salem Al-Dawsari's incredible strike. His goal not only showcased individual brilliance but also underlined Saudi Arabia's growing confidence. The team's ability to adapt and push forward while maintaining defensive solidity caught Argentina off guard, leaving them chasing the game.

Argentina's attempts to equalize were met with fierce resistance from Saudi Arabia's defense, which stood firm despite the intense pressure. The final whistle signaled a historic win for Saudi Arabia, one that will be etched in the memories of their fans for years to come.

Post-Match Analysis: What Went Wrong for Argentina?

  • Lack of Cohesion: Argentina's performance was marred by a lack of cohesion among their players. The team's attacking and defensive units seemed disconnected, leading to misplaced passes and uncapitalized opportunities.
  • Defensive Lapses: Defensive errors, particularly in dealing with set pieces and quick transitions, proved costly for Argentina. These lapses allowed Saudi Arabia to capitalize on their limited chances.
  • Ineffective Substitutions: Argentina's substitutions failed to inject the desired spark, with the introductions of fresh players not significantly altering the game's trajectory.

For Saudi Arabia, this victory marks a monumental upset that will boost their morale and ambitions in the tournament. Their ability to execute a well-planned strategy and capitalize on their chances underlines their potential as dark horses in the competition.
